On October 11th, 2024, the opening ceremony of “The Spirit of Educators Never Stops: CAFA Teaching Heritage Exhibition”, the 2024 Double Ninth Festival Blessings and the CAFA Briefing were held at CAFA Art Museum. Senior misters, professors, cadres and faculty members of the Central Academy of Fine Arts gathered at CAFA Art Museum to celebrate the Double Ninth Festival. Xu Yang, Secretary of the CAFA Party Committee extended greetings for the Double Ninth Festival, Lin Mao, President of CAFA made a briefing on the current development of CAFA, and Wang Xiaolin, Deputy Secretary of the CAFA Party Committee presided over the event.

All the members at CAFA are accustomed to honoring our mentors as “misters”, and “senior misters” are the idols revered by all of us. Misters’ persuasive and sincere teachings have continuously introduced young students to the art world;  generations of students insist on diligent pursuit by following misters’ instructions, which ensures that the misters never leave the classrooms. As time goes by, the younger generations of students gradually become misters, inheriting the glorious tradition and continuing the centennial academic lineage.

Ushering in a new chapter of “CAFA Misters & New Epoch”, “The Spirit of Educators Never Stops: CAFA Teaching Heritage Exhibition” is exactly a vivid reflection of the aesthetic education practices, inheritance of aesthetic education ideals, and promotion of aesthetic education spirit based on CAFA’s centennial academic heritage. With the inter-textual duo of “teacher and student”, the exhibition tells the inheritance stories of teachers and students from the School of Chinese Painting, the School of Calligraphy, the Department of Oil Painting, the Printmaking Department, the Department of Sculpture, the Department of Mural, and the Fundamental Department of Plastic Arts, striving to outline a clear academic context and vivid inheritance relationship, which further comprehensively demonstrates the aesthetic education scroll drawn by “what misters have taught,” and “what are learned by young students.”
